Challenger Middle School is a roomy elementary campus in GLENDALE, Arizona, run under Glendale Elementary District (4271). The school works with 839 students in grades K through 8. By comparison, Arizona's public schools average about 451 students each, so Challenger Middle School sits 86% larger than that benchmark.
Across the 14 schools in Glendale Elementary District (4271) (8,580 students total), Challenger Middle School accounts for its share of the district's footprint.
Demographically, Challenger Middle School shows that Hispanic students make up the majority at 66%. Other groups include 14% Black, 9% White, 6% Asian, 2% multiracial. That is visibly more Hispanic than the county at large, where the share is closer to 31%.
In terms of school funding signals, On paper, Challenger Middle School has 41 full-time-equivalent teachers, translating to a class-load average of around 20.7:1. Statewide, the average ratio sits near 17.0:1, putting Challenger Middle School higher than the state norm the norm.
Across the wider county, Maricopa County reports that median household income runs about $89,300, 37%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and census figures put the poverty rate at about 8%. Challenger Middle School is one of 1352 public schools in Maricopa County (combined enrollment of about 725,139 students).
The closest other public school is Desert Garden Elementary School, roughly 0.4 miles away. Counting just inside five miles, 8 other public schools cluster around Challenger Middle School.
The campus sits in a commuter-belt setting.
Looking at the recent track record. Looking back 7 years, enrollment at Challenger Middle School has expanded 16%, going from 721 students in 2018 to 839 in 2025. Class-load math has pulled in: from 21.9:1 in 2018 to 20.7:1 in 2025.
